Who is the gastroenterologist?

Gastroenterology is the branch of internal medicine that studies the most appropriate characteristics and methods of treatment for diseases of the digestive system.

The gastroenterologist, therefore, is an internal doctor specialized in the diagnosis and treatment of diseases that can affect the esophagus, the stomach, the small intestine, the large intestine and the hepato-biliary system (liver, pancreas, gall bladder and ducts). biliary) of the human being.

COMPETENCES OF THE GASTROENTEROLOGIST

The gastroenterologist is an expert on digestive motility, or the movements of food since it is ingested until it reaches the last section of intestine.

It is also extremely prepared on everything that happens during the digestive process, from the absorption of nutrients (where sugars are absorbed, where instead fats? Etc.) to the elimination of waste products (feces).

Finally, he knows the digestive functions of the liver very well.

WHAT DISTURBANCES CARE THE GASTROENTEROLOGIST?

It is good to rely on a gastroenterologist if you suffer from:

  • Strong and persistent abdominal pain
  • Blood loss within the digestive system
  • A neoplasm of the stomach, intestine, pancreas or liver
  • Constipation or diarrhea
  • Dysphagia (difficulty swallowing)
  • Colon disorders (intestinal polyps, irritable bowel syndrome, colitis, Crohn's disease, diverticulitis, etc.)
  • Gallbladder problems
  • Gastroesophageal reflux
  • Chronic heartburn
  • Hemorrhoids
  • Hiatal hernia
  • Gastritis
  • Ulcers
  • Celiac disease
  • Recurrent nausea and vomiting
